Georgetown University blocked concerned Catholics and reporters from attending todays campus lecture by Planned Parenthood President Cecile Richards, but tweets from participating students revealed faithful Catholics worst fears: Richards spoke to a packed auditorium, flagrantly advocating abortion, deriding pro-lifers and scandalizing students at the nations oldest Catholic university.
Richards was introduced by the student group H*yas for Choice, according to a tweet from The Hoyas Twitter page, once again demonstrating the substantial leeway given by Georgetown to this unofficial pro-abortion club. I cant wait to come back when this [H*yas for Choice] is a recognized campus group, Richards reportedly stated upon taking the stage. A girl can dream. H*yas for Choice is responsible for numerous scandals at Georgetown, such as hosting choice weeks, protesting pro-life conferences and pushing for contraception distribution on campus.
In early March, The Cardinal Newman Society broke the news that Georgetowns student-run Lecture Fund would be hosting Richards. The Archdiocese of Washington and its newspaper, the Catholic Standard, were quick to criticize the outrageous event, but the University administration refused to rescind Richards invitation.

As expected, the event seems to have been a platform for Richards to indoctrinate students with pro-abortion rhetoric and repeatedly attack the dignity of human life. Richards reportedly denied that Planned Parenthood ever sold fetal tissue and claimed abortion is a basic human right.
A campus newspaper, The Hoya, used Twitter to quote Richards throughout the event. Among the tweets:

One Georgetown senior, Amber Athey, also sought to expose the event by live-tweeting some of Cecile Richards and the Lecture Funds most outrageous quotes using the hashtag #CecileAtGU. [T]o my knowledge the event was NOT videotaped, so this was a way of informing the public #CecileAtGU,Athey explained at the end of her messaging.
So far I have heard pro-lifers referred to as crazies and protestors had their right to protest questioned #CecileAtGU, Atheys live messaging began. Athey also tweeted that the head of the GU Lecture Fund claimed that hosting an abortion provider is in the spirit of a Jesuit university, and, even more disturbingly, that God is pro-choice. The rest of Atheys tweets capture the disturbing content of Richards lecture to students and the dishearteningly positive response of attendees. Georgetown students reportedly gave Richards a standing ovation and cheered when Richards spoke about more abortion clinics being opened.

The tweets give added emphasis to the prior statement of the Archdiocese of Washington: What we lament and find sadly lacking in this choice by the student group is any reflection of what should be an environment of morality, ethics and human decency that one expects on a campus that asserts its Jesuit and Catholic history and identity.
The statement continued:
The apparent unawareness of those pushing the violence of abortion and the denigration of human dignity that there are other human values and issues being challenged in the world lends credence to the perception of the ivory tower life of some on campus. This unfortunately does not speak well for the future. One would hope to see this generation of Georgetown graduates have a far less self-absorbed attitude when facing neighbors and those in need, especially the most vulnerable among us.
